Key responsibilities include entry of transactional data into the
appropriate operating systems, record maintenance for both purchase
and sales, completion of the transactional piece of transportation
logistics, assisting the Merchandiser with freight negotiations,
handling Customer / Supplier requests & issues. You will also
coordinate with the Accounting Department to insure timely
processing of invoices / payments, reconciliation of receipt
discrepancies and reconciliation of invoice discrepancies.
